Abstract

The utility model discloses a resistance position sensor, which comprises a dry reed switch, a converter and a cylindrical shell, wherein the dry reed switch comprises a circuit board and a plurality of resistors, the converter comprises a conjunction box and a one-chip microcomputer, the dry reed switch is arranged in the cylindrical shell to form an enclosed space, the one-chip microcomputer of the converter is disposed in the conjunction box, the conjunction box is placed at one end of the cylindrical shell, and the one-chip microcomputer is connected with the dry reed switch. The resistance position sensor is simple in structure, low in cost, wide in application scope, and is particularly suitable for the field of liquid level stroke position sensing.

Background technology
Related position transducer mainly comprises the position transducer of electronic position sensor and Mechanical Contact formula in the present industry.Wherein, Mechanical Contact formula position transducer mainly exists application limited, the problem that induction precision is low; Although and electronic sensor such as electronic ruler etc. can improve induction precision, its electronic system complexity, the shortcoming that manufacturing cost is high are also very obvious, so its range of application also has been subjected to certain influence.

Embodiment
Below in conjunction with embodiment the utility model is further elaborated.
As shown in the figure, the utility model resistance position transducer, it comprises dry reed switch, converter and cylindrical shell 1, dry reed switch comprises wiring board 2 and resistance 3, converter is made up of terminal box 4 and single-chip microcomputer 5, and wherein dry reed switch is arranged on and forms a confined space in the cylindrical shell 1, and the single-chip microcomputer 5 of converter places in the terminal box 4, terminal box 4 places an end of cylindrical shell 1, and single-chip microcomputer 5 is connected with dry reed switch; Wherein the resistance 3 of dry reed switch is for being connected in series, and is fixed on the wiring board 2, and the scope of resistance switching current is 4-20mA.
The utility model resistance position transducer during work, is passed to dry reed switch resistance 3 by the signal that displacement produces, and resistance converts electric current to after single-chip microcomputer 5 imports into monolithic higher level instrument and meter after accepting reads.
